Finally beginning the 1974 1.8 T conversion. Bought the donor car over 1 year ago and began stripping it out last week. The goal is to modernize the cockpit and cabin a bit to enjoy things like Cruise control and A/C and intermittent wipers and boast power a <bit>with a KO4 turbo. The donor car was a 1999 Passat 1.8T longitudinal 5 speed.
I was inspired by both Mike Bellis and Andrew Dallens conversions. I don’t have big aspirations for enormous HP gains. I’ll be satisfied at 165-175Hp. I plan on using the original Passat gearbox and custom fab the axles and cable shifters. Ideally I’d like to design the cooling system and intercooler to stay in the original engine bay, but we shall see. Attached thumbnail(s) |

Nice project, I built a Mk1 Scirocco with the 1.8T and it turned out plenty fast with just the stock 180 hp engine (traction was an issue into third gear) The Scirocco is a little lighter than the 914 but its only about 100 kg difference and rear wheel drive will make it awsome. If you want to keep the stock look I'd look at a small watercooled intercooler, much more efficient and easier to find room for.
